About Martha Cooper
Martha Cooper, born on October 21, 1943 in Baltimore, Maryland, is a photographer and photojournalist renowned for introducing the world to the subculture of graffiti. Her captivating documentation of the graffiti scene in New York City has been featured in esteemed publications such as The New York Post, National Geographic, and Smithsonian.
Prior to her prolific career as a photographer, Cooper obtained an art degree from Grinnell College. It was during a visit to Japan that her interest in photography flourished while capturing images of tattoos.
A notable milestone in her career is the publication of Subway Art (1984), a collection of graffiti photography often regarded as “the Bible of street art.” Martha Cooper’s impact on street art culture extends beyond her photography; she also holds significance for being married to an anthropologist.
